I have a feeling there are also trading bots on IMX market. Not everywhere, but only about some cards selling for GODS. I was obsessed by buying and selling cards and watching things closely last 3 weeks. I did 381 trades during this time :)
And I have noticed you can try selling a cards for many days without result because, in a minute or two after you post a card on the market, two other (previously cheapest) cards slightly change their price to stand before you. First, I thought it was a real person, a stubborn and insane one like me :), but no this is not possible. 1stly, I wake up and go to sleep at a quite random time and this is strange that I encounter these things at any time of the day. 2ndly, there was a pattern about changing prices - a real person wouldn't repeat the same price change every time. 3rdly, price changes endlessly. What to do? Sell your card for ETH, not GODS. I believe someone was buying for ETH and selling for GODS and decided to develop the super profitable business by means of using a bot...
